Egypt condemns 14 to death for 2011 Sinai attack

ISMAILIA, Egypt (Reuters) - An Egyptian court sentenced 14 Islamist militants to death on Tuesday for killing policemen and soldiers during an attack on a police station in North Sinai last year, a court official said.

The ruling may add to tension in the volatile region bordering Israel, where fighting between security forces and militants has intensified since August 5 when 16 border guards were killed in an attack blamed on Islamist groups.
